What is an executive TS SCI Full Scope Polygraph?

Executive TS/SCI Full Scope Polygraph positions are high-level roles, often in government or defense sectors, that require both Top Secret/Sensitive Compartmented Information (TS/SCI) clearance and a Full Scope Polygraph. These positions involve access to highly classified information critical to national security and require individuals to undergo rigorous background investigations and polygraph examinations. Executives in these roles typically oversee sensitive projects, manage teams with clearance requirements, and ensure strict compliance with security protocols. Due to the nature of the information involved, these positions are among the most stringently vetted in the security clearance process.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an executive with TS SCI Full Scope Polygraph clearance?

To thrive as an Executive with TS/SCI Full Scope Polygraph clearance, you need extensive leadership experience, a background in national security or intelligence, and the requisite active security clearance. Familiarity with classified information handling systems, secure communication protocols, and advanced project management tools is typically required. Superior judgment, discretion, and strong interpersonal skills are critical for managing sensitive operations and leading cross-functional teams. These skills and qualifications are essential to ensure the safe, effective management of highly confidential missions critical to national security.

What are the primary challenges faced by an executive with a TS SCI Full Scope Polygraph, and how can they be managed?

Executives with a TS/SCI Full Scope Polygraph clearance often face challenges related to handling highly sensitive information and adhering to strict security protocols. Balancing leadership responsibilities with compliance requirements can be demanding, especially when coordinating with teams that have varied clearance levels. Effective communication, ongoing security training, and fostering a culture of trust and transparency are essential for managing these challenges. Regular collaboration with security officers and continuous awareness of evolving regulations help ensure both operational effectiveness and security compliance.
